NRS 40.681 — Premediation discovery.
Nevada Revised Statutes, Chapter 40 — ACTIONS AND PROCEEDINGS IN PARTICULAR CASES CONCERNING PROPERTY

Not later than 15 days before the commencement of mediation required pursuant to NRS 40.680 and upon providing 15 days’ notice, each party shall provide to the other party, or shall make a reasonable effort to assist the other party to obtain, all relevant reports, photos, correspondence, plans, specifications, warranties, contracts, subcontracts, work orders for repair, videotapes, technical reports, soil and other engineering reports and other documents or materials relating to the claim that are not privileged.
